Saudi Arabia’s Ministry of Health launched yesterday, July 20, the transformation project from applying cash-basis accounting to accrual accounting at its headquarters in the Kingdom’s Digital City.

 

The actual launch of the project comes after the success of the pilot phase, which was took place after the issuance of a royal decree approving the conversion of all government agencies to accrual accounting, Saudi Press Agency (SPA) reported.

 

The ministry is one of the first government agencies to adopt this project, which comes in accordance with international accounting standards in the public sector in a bid to strengthen the country's financial position.

 

The project is positioned to achieve one of the pillars of the Kingdom's Vision 2030 in relation to improving the quality of financial accounts and enhancing transparency to improve the government accounting system and accounting audit standards.
